What makes the best gifts for devotional women?
A great devotional gift should feel personal, useful, and uplifting. That sounds simple, but it helps narrow things down fast. Some gifts are deeply practical, like a journal she will actually write in. Others are more sentimental, like a necklace with a meaningful symbol or verse reference. The best ones often combine both, giving her something she will reach for often while still feeling thoughtful and special.
It also depends on her season of life. A college student might love compact, portable pieces she can toss into a tote bag between class and church. A busy mom may appreciate anything that makes a five-minute quiet time feel beautiful and doable. A close friend walking through a hard season may want comfort more than novelty. Devotional gifting is never one-size-fits-all, and that is exactly why it can feel so meaningful when you get it right.

Journals are always a yes - if they have a purpose
A blank journal can be lovely, but a little structure often makes it more usable. Prayer journals, gratitude journals, and guided reflection notebooks tend to feel less intimidating than empty pages. They give her a starting point, which means she is more likely to stick with it.
If she already journals often, a beautifully designed notebook with thick pages and a feminine cover is still a strong choice. It adds delight to a habit she already loves. If she is newer to devotional routines, guided prompts may serve her better.
This is one of those gifts where presentation matters too. A journal wrapped with a soft pen, a set of pastel highlighters, or a few pretty page tabs feels instantly more giftable. It turns a simple object into a small ritual kit.

Build a devotional gift set that feels curated
If you want your gift to feel extra special, create a small bundle instead of choosing one standalone item. This works beautifully for devotional women because their routines are often made up of several little pieces used together.
A lovely combination might include a weekly devotional, a journal, and a simple pair of earrings for a gift that feels heartfelt and polished. Another sweet option is a notebook paired with a delicate necklace and a pretty accessory she can use every day. If you are working with a smaller budget, even two thoughtfully matched items can feel intentional and complete.
The key is not overstuffing it. A curated gift feels charming when everything belongs together. Too many random pieces can make it feel less personal, even if the individual items are cute.
